Zscaler’s stock suffered a sharp sell-off, heading for a record one-day decline of over 31%, based on market data. The plunge came after the cybersecurity company provided a revenue outlook that fell short of market expectations, blindsiding many investors. While specific financial figures from the outlook were not detailed in the initial report, the downbeat guidance triggered a swift and severe negative reaction. Trading volume surged to elevated levels, indicating broad-based selling pressure. The magnitude of the decline suggests that the outlook was a stark contrast to prior optimistic assessments. Zscaler, known for its cloud-based security platform, had previously delivered steady revenue growth. The disappointing forecast, therefore, represents a notable shift in the company’s near-term trajectory. The stock’s performance on this trading day is poised to become the worst single-day drop on record, erasing billions of dollars in market value. The key takeaway from this event is the unexpected nature of the guidance miss. Analysts and investors may have been caught off guard, as Zscaler had not issued any prior warnings. The sharp decline indicates that the market was pricing in a continuation of the company’s historical growth rates. The sell-off could signal broader concerns about the cybersecurity sector’s spending environment, where enterprises might be delaying or reducing investments. Competitors in the cloud security space could potentially face increased scrutiny, as Zscaler’s outlook may reflect industry-wide headwinds rather than company-specific issues. On the other hand, if the disappointment is isolated to Zscaler’s execution, peers might see a relative opportunity. The event also underscores the risk of high-growth tech stocks being especially sensitive to forward-looking guidance, where even a modest shortfall can trigger outsized price moves.
